    Choosing Upvc Window Replacement Hinges

    It's not as difficult as it may seem to choose and fit the replacement hinges made of upvc. Make sure that the arrows on the hinges face the right way and then measure the thickness of the hinge arms on the frame that opens (13mm or17mm).

    There are several types of hinges to choose from, each one with distinctive features. This article will review some of the most common uPVC hinges and their benefits.

    Egress/Easy Clean Hinge

    These are a great choice to replace or upgrade your fire escape safety windows as they open to a full 90 degree angle. They can be removed in an easy-cleaning position, allowing you to access the windows' exterior without the need to climb ladders or lean at dangerous angles.

    These egress hinges are heavy-duty and are made by Yale one of the most known and respected home security brands on the market today. These hinges are compatible with any kind of uPVC side-hung windows. They can be moved into the easy-clean position by pressing the small button and moving the double glazed window hinge repair sash to one side. After closing, the sash will be reset to its original position.

    They are available in 13mm and 17mm stack heights. Depending on the size of your window, we suggest using our Egress Selection Guide to determine the best product for you.

    These hinges can be fitted to conventional side-hung frames made of uPVC, or aluminium. The friction screw is used to adjust the resistance. This makes opening the window more simple and reduces the chance of a mistaken closing in severe winds. They have been tested to more than 30000 cycles and are in compliance with BBA/Secured by Design and British Standards approved BS EN 13126-6:2008.

    With no buttons or catches the Nico Egress Easy Clean Friction Hinge is easy to use and offers a practical solution for emergency egress and secure cleaning. The hinge retention clip is located on the inside of the bottom corner. This will release the bottom and top catches which will allow you to slide the sash into an easy-clean position. Close the window when you have the sash in an easy-cleaning position. This will reset the hinges to their Egress positions.

    Fire-Escape Hinge

    Fire Escape Hinges (also known as "Easy Clean") are used to replace side-opening windows for fire safety reasons. These types of window hinges are more spacious and more efficient than standard hinges to allow a large clear opening to escape in the case of an incident of fire. This kind of hinge is a legal requirement in any room that has a window, according to building regulations.

    Restricted Hinge

    Standard hinges can make it difficult to open a window fully. These restricted child safety friction hinges can help overcome this issue and offer a fantastic solution when ventilation is required but access for cleaning or escape in case of fire is not feasible. They limit the number of times you can opening the sash and allow for the bypass of this restriction by pressing the button. They work with both top and side hung windows. They are available in 13mm and 17mm stack heights.

    The Nico Restricted Egress Hinges combine the features of both the standard restrictor, as well as a pivot for fire escape to provide a simple but efficient way to meet building regulations. It is available in 13mm and 17mm stack heights and is suitable for both top and side opening uPVC window. It comes in two pieces with one hinge being the one with restricted egress and the other the unrestricted. This permits one hinge to be installed at the bottom and the other is installed on top.

    These uPVC hinges are restrictive and have been tested to BS6375 part 2 and are designed for use on a window that isn't able to be fully opened, like a small child's bedroom. The mechanism limits the amount the sash can open to 100mm for safety and then re-engages when the window is closed.
